Output e133a3653c039d2161792ab84d20e5693a21c8d8fdf1f0276a32d2e43c382800:1

value
17984046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a005ee8e8a34b5204863847fb8e9e34f99c7a7e7 OP_EQUALVERIFY OP_CHECKSIG
address
1Fb8Dr4btNgaQF1QydUMR2R4Y7hVPdAg5R
transaction
e133a3653c039d2161792ab84d20e5693a21c8d8fdf1f0276a32d2e43c382800
spent
true